Before anything else, calculate how much house you can afford. This will help you set a price range while house shopping in Pacifica. After that, jot down your potential monthly payments (including property taxes, insurance, home repairs, homeowners association fees, etc.). You don't need an exact amount for these expenses. While everyone's situation is different, an online search for Pacifica averages will usually give you some solid estimates. Keep in mind that your monthly mortgage payment could make up the bulk of your monthly home expenses.
Then, look at how much money you can put toward a down payment. A down payment of at least 20% can help improve your chances of getting a great rate and will allow you to avoid private mortgage insurance (PMI). However, down payment requirements can differ depending on the loan type. At this stage, getting prequalified for a loan can be extremely helpful. Prequalification points you in the right direction as far as how much you may be eligible to borrow. Also, consider your credit profile. Credit history is an important part of your mortgage application. You may be presented with more mortgage options if you have healthy credit— and options are always a good thing!
